Q: Is 1,753,972 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,753,972 is a composite number.

Why is 1,753,972 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,753,972 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 11 22 44 39,863 79,726 159,452 438,493 876,986 and 1,753,972, with no remainder.

Since 1,753,972 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,753,972, it is a composite number.
